电商平台的测试方法步骤是确保平台在上线前能够正常运行、安全且满足用户需求的关键。以下是详细的测试步骤:
1. 需求分析与规划:
- 与产品经理和开发团队紧密合作,明确测试目标和范围。
- 制定详细的测试计划,包括测试环境搭建、测试用例设计、资源分配等。
2. 环境搭建与准备:
- 搭建测试环境,包括硬件、软件、网络等。
- 确保测试环境与生产环境尽可能一致,以便模拟真实场景。
3. 功能测试:
- 按照功能模块划分测试用例,确保每个功能点都能正常实现。
- 对关键功能进行压力测试,验证系统在高并发情况下的稳定性。
- 对异常情况进行测试,如用户输入错误、数据丢失等,确保系统能正确处理。
4. 性能测试:
- 测试系统的响应时间、吞吐量、并发用户数等性能指标。
- 使用负载测试工具模拟大量用户访问,观察系统表现。
- 对数据库进行性能测试,确保查询速度和数据一致性。
5. 安全性测试:
- 对登录、支付、隐私等关键功能进行安全测试。
- 检查系统是否存在SQL注入、XSS攻击等安全漏洞。
- 对数据传输过程进行加密测试,确保数据安全。
6. 兼容性测试:
- 在不同浏览器、操作系统、移动设备上测试平台的兼容性。
- 确保所有功能在各种设备上都能正常工作。
7. 用户体验测试:
- 邀请真实用户参与测试,收集反馈意见。
- 分析用户行为数据,优化界面设计和交互流程。
8. 自动化测试:
- 利用自动化测试工具进行回归测试,确保代码变更不会导致问题。
- 定期执行自动化测试,提高测试效率。
9. 缺陷管理与跟踪:
- 建立缺陷管理机制,确保所有发现的缺陷都能被记录、分类和跟踪。
- 定期回顾缺陷报告,分析问题原因,优化产品。
10. 测试报告与总结:
- 编写详细的测试报告,记录测试结果、发现的问题及建议。
- 根据测试结果调整产品,完善测试策略。
通过以上步骤,可以确保电商平台在上线前达到预期的质量标准,为用户提供稳定、安全、便捷的购物体验。